Interesting facts about George Bernard Shaw

  • George Bernard Shaw was a vegetarian yet a staunch vivisectionist [using animals for research purposes]
  • Shaw is perhaps the only recipient of both the Nobel Prize and the Academy Award.
  • He won the Nobel Prize for Literature in 1925.
  • Shaw won the Oscar for Best Adapted Screenplay for Pygmalion [Screen Name of film – My Fair Lady] in the year 1938.
  • Shaw was very fond of riding motorcycles
  • Shaw‘s prefaces to his plays were extremely lengthy, where he expounded his political views. At times the preface was much longer than the play itself.
  • Shaw’s picture appeared on the cover of the Beatles’ Album Sgt. Pepper’s Lonely Hearts Club Band
  • Shaw was active till the end and died at the age of 94 due to injuries he sustained after falling off a ladder in his garden.
  • Shaw was not buried but cremated and his ashes scattered all over his estate.
